The statement issued by the Izmir Governorate states that the ban on the imposed will be implemented for 5 days to March 5.
On the other hand, the Turkish capital also banned any rally for 7 days, with the announcement of the Ankara governorate.
After the arrest of Istanbul mayor Akram Imamoglu, who is the main rival of Turkish President Recep Tayyip Erdogan, its cities, especially Istanbul, became the scene of widespread protests against the government.
Istanbul’s Office of Attorney General Akram Imamoglu on Wednesday issued the arrest of Akram Imamoglu, the mayor of the city and four others on charges of “corruption, bribery and terrorism-related crimes”; The protesters, however, were the arrest of Imamoglu not a judicial procedure but the government’s “political action” of the government to eliminate competitors and the “coup against the constitution” of Türkiye.
